NASA Selects Mission to Study Black Holes, Cosmic X-ray Mysteries NASA has selected a science mission that will allow astronomers to explore, for the first time, the hidden details of some of the most extreme and exotic astronomical objects, such as stellar and supermassive black holes, neutron stars and pulsars.

The southern lights over the Pacific Ocean south of western Australia, as viewed from the ISS on August 11, 2016. A SpaceX Dragon spacecraft is also visible at the top-left corner. Goodnight !

•••An incredible photo taken from the International Space Station (ISS) of Western Europe. England is visible in the top right of the photo, Paris is the bright city in the middle and views of Belgium and the Netherlands are towards the middle-right of the picture.
